What is fire damage restoration?

Fire damage restoration is a systematic process aimed at returning a property affected by fire and smoke to its pre-loss condition. This involves a thorough assessment, meticulous cleaning of soot and smoke residue using specialized equipment and chemical agents, odor neutralization, structural drying, and the repair or replacement of damaged materials. What's the difference between remediation and restoration?

Remediation typically refers to the initial phase of addressing immediate hazards, such as containing smoke, removing debris, and preventing further damage, often involving the mitigation of hazardous substances. Restoration then encompasses the subsequent steps of cleaning, repairing, and rebuilding to return the property to its functional and aesthetic pre-fire state. Is anything salvageable after a fire?

In many cases, a significant portion of a property's contents and structural elements can be salvaged after a fire, depending on the severity and type of blaze. Our technicians employ advanced cleaning and restoration techniques, such as ultrasonic cleaning for delicate items and specialized chemical treatments for soot removal, to restore a wide array of materials.
